错误 #4356
B5G终端版本V0.0.1_T06,dd口am模式下两终端互ping包出现周期性大时延(几百ms)
开始日期:
2025-10-30
计划完成日期:
% 完成:
0%
预期时间:
描述
简述:B5G终端版本V0.0.1_T06,dd口am模式下两终端互相ping包时周期性出现大时延包(几百ms)
测试版本:V0.0.1_T06
问题描述:B5G终端版本V0.0.1_T06,dd口am模式下两终端互相ping包时周期性出现大时延包(几百ms)

文件
历史记录
由 王 艳芳 更新于 4 天 之前
【问题原因】
1 通过问题复现,抓取PING包的LOG,与协议栈LOG对比分析,PING包时延大的包是因为发端的PING REQUREST数据包在接收端出现CRC ERROR而丢失,所以问题归结为RLC AM的重传时延过大的问题。
2 RLC AM重传的机制是发端在数据包携带Poll信息,触发接收端发送状态报告,然后发端解析状态报告的NACK信息后重传NACK SN的数据包。目前时延问题的根源是发端的POLL信息触发不及时,导致接收端触发状态报告的时延过大,从而发端重传的时延也过大。
【解决方案】完善发端t-PollRetransmit超时处理机制,减小状态报告的触发时延。
【提交版本】代码完成并测试后,计划于下个发布版本提交